Career path

Career Role (Electronics Recycling) Description
Electronics Recycling Technician Handles the disassembly, sorting, and processing of electronic waste; a key role in the materials recycling process. Requires practical skills and adherence to safety protocols.
Waste Management Specialist (e-waste focus) Manages the entire lifecycle of electronic waste, from collection to disposal and recycling. Involves logistics, regulatory compliance, and environmental responsibility.
Materials Recovery Specialist Focuses on the recovery of valuable materials from e-waste, employing techniques like smelting and chemical separation. Strong knowledge of materials science is vital.
E-waste Auditor & Compliance Officer Ensures compliance with environmental regulations related to the management of electronic waste, conducting audits and reporting on sustainability initiatives.
Sustainable Electronics Design Engineer Designs electronic products with recyclability and material recovery in mind; a crucial step towards a circular economy for electronics.
